Vanina Prache advises on all aspects of employment and labour law, providing both strategic counsel and operational support to companies. She assists senior executives, HR directors, and operational teams in structuring and implementing social policies, managing social dialogue, and leading organizational transformations. She has extensive expertise in collective bargaining, management of employee representative bodies, dispute resolution, disciplinary matters, international mobility, workforce planning, and HR management. Her approach is both rigorous and pragmatic, allowing her to deliver tailored solutions aligned with her clients’ economic and human challenges in complex and evolving environments.

Previous Experiences

  • Counsel, Gordon S. Blair Law Offices (Monaco) – since April 2025
  • Groupe LabelVie – HR Director France (2022 – March 2025)
  • Ariane Group – Deputy Director of Labour Relations (2021–2022)
  • Naval Group – HR Director of the Toulon site (2018–2021)
  • GBH – Head of Labour Relations and International Mobility (2014–2018)
  • Naval Group (2003–2014)
  • Also: Employment law associate (Cabinet Chevallier, Brest), Head of the Social Department at an accounting firm (HDM, Réunion Island), Legal advisor at the Federation of Beauty Companies, Lecturer in business law at the University of Réunion.

Education

  • University Diploma in Monegasque Labour Law – University of Montpellier
  • DEA (Master of Advanced Studies) in Business and Economic Law – University of Paris I Panthéon-Sorbonne
  • Certification in “Legal Framework of International Mobility” – Magellan Institute
